WebVenofer (iron sucrose) is given as an injection into the veins (intravenously or IV) by a trained healthcare provider. It can be given as a slow injection over 2 to 5 minutes or as an infusion. The time it takes to infuse Venofer (iron sucrose) depends on your age, if you're on dialysis, and the type of dialysis you need.

WebMar 20, 2024 · Iron infusion can help combat anemia by r estoring healthy levels of iron to the system, which is essential for producing hemoglobin, the protein in red blood cells that carries oxygen. Iron infusion can improve the hemoglobin levels, iron stores, and quality of life of patients with anemia. WebMay 29, 2024 · Low iron levels vary between individuals and depend on a person’s sex. A score below 26 mcg/dL is outside the normal range for women. For men, a low score is anything below 76 mcg/dL.
